About yahoo directory...I have few listings there and it was worth it before they closed all international directories. Before when you submit your site you were getting 4-5 links(yahoo ca dir, yahoo au dir etc etc.) and you should know that this is recurring fee. I did cancelled the card I paid for the listings and after 5 years my listings are still alive. Anyway I still believe it has good value.
